Hey man I have the AEM on my 96. It is 2.5" compared to Injen's 3", don't know if you can really feel a difference between 2.5" and 3"... I can't. Both feel better than stock to me though. Both sound nice also.
If you get red or silver and want to change sometime for a blue one let me know. I'm going to paint my car red and I think my blue stands out kinda superman-ish. lol.
Seriously though, as long as you can find a shop that will do the bends for you you may be better off just getting one custom made and a k&n filter.
I got a 3" ebay intake before the AEM and it was nice. The angle of the bends was just a tad off which I think could have been easily adjusted.
If I could go back in time I would have saved my money and stuck with the 3" ebay intake with the k&n filter, not that AEM is not good, just overpriced as are all Name brand intakes.
